| dc.description | We study the stability of Z_2 topological vortex excitations in d+1 dimensional SU(2) Yang-Mills theory on the lattice at T=0. This is found to depend on d and on the coupling considered. We discuss the connection with lattice artifacts causing bulk transitions in the beta_A-beta_F plane and draw some conclusions regarding the continuum limit of the theory. | |
